
Linux 开源操作系统 发布文章
Linux 开源操作系统 发布文章
修改密码复杂度 不知从何讲起,直接贴配置文件吧 配置文件:/etc/pam.d/system-auth ,保存即生效 其实system-auth这个文件是个链接文件在同目录的system-auth-ac,这两个修改哪一个都行 1 #%PAM-1.0 2 # This file is auto-generated. 3 # User changes will be destroyed the next time authconfig is run. 4 auth requi..
/etc/login.defs 是设置用户帐号限制的文件。该文件里的配置对root用户无效。 如果/etc/shadow文件里有相同的选项,则以/etc/shadow里的设置为准,也就是说/etc/shadow的配置优先级高于/etc/login.defs # *REQUIRED* required# Directory where mailboxes reside, _or_ name of file, relative to the# home directory. If you ..
tar -c: 建立压缩档案 -x:解压 -t:查看内容 -r:向压缩归档文件末尾追加文件 -u:更新原压缩包中的文件 这五个是独立的命令,压缩解压都要用到其中一个,可以和别的命令连用但只能用其中一个。下面的参数是根据需要在压缩或解压档案时可选的。 -z:有gzip属性的 -j:有bz2属性的 -Z:有compress属性的 -v:显示所有过程 -O:将文件解开到..
$0:当前脚本的文件名 $num:num为从1开始的数字,$1是第一个参数,$2是第二个参数,${10}是第十个参数 $#:传入脚本的参数的个数 $*:所有的位置参数(作为单个字符串) $@:所有的位置参数(每个都作为独立的字符串)。 $?:当前shell进程中,上一个命令的返回值,如果上一个命令成功执行则$?的值为0,否则为其他非零值,常用做if语句条件 $$:当前..
双引号: awk '{print "\""}' #放大:awk '{print " \" "}' 使用“”双引号把一个双引号括起来,然后用转义字符\对双引号进行转义,输出双引号。 单引号: awk '{print "'\''"}' # 放大: awk '{print " ' \ '..
对于输出字符串使用到单引号: 单引号-双引号-单引号-转义单引号-单引号-字符串-单引号-转义单引号-单引号-双引号-单引号(下划线部分为输出单引号,相同颜色符号对应) cat user.txt | awk '{ if($2!=""){ print "update user set u_id='\''" $1 "'\'' , u_ali=1 whe..